The Trap of Hardware Dependency in Current AI
Most existing AI applications are tightly coupled to specific model providers, runtimes, clouds, and chips, creating a significant dependency problem. This reliance on particular hardware or software stacks leads to technical debt that becomes increasingly difficult to manage as hardware economics evolve rapidly. Developers frequently struggle to move beyond a simple "works on my machine" mindset, hindering broader deployment.
"Most of the AI applications that's been built today are tightly tied to something or the other. So it could be a model provider, a runtime, a cloud, a chip and in fact all of it." said Kavya, highlighting the pervasive issue.
